探索jPlayer GitHub:开源音乐播放器的魅力
探索jPlayer GitHub:开源音乐播放器的魅力
在开源社区中,jPlayer 是一个备受瞩目的项目。作为一个基于JavaScript的多媒体播放器,jPlayer 不仅功能强大,而且灵活性极高。今天,我们就来深入了解一下jPlayer GitHub,以及它在实际应用中的表现。
jPlayer简介
jPlayer 是一个纯JavaScript编写的多媒体播放器,支持HTML5和Flash回退。它由Mark J. O'Sullivan开发,旨在提供一个跨平台、跨浏览器的音频和视频播放解决方案。jPlayer 的设计初衷是让开发者能够轻松地在网页上嵌入多媒体内容,而无需担心浏览器兼容性问题。
GitHub上的jPlayer
在GitHub 上,jPlayer 的项目页面(jPlayer GitHub)提供了丰富的资源,包括源代码、文档、示例和社区讨论。以下是jPlayer GitHub 的一些亮点:
-
开源许可:jPlayer 采用MIT许可证,这意味着开发者可以自由地使用、修改和分发该项目。
-
活跃的社区:jPlayer 拥有活跃的开发者和用户社区,经常有新的功能和bug修复被提交。
-
丰富的文档:项目页面提供了详细的API文档和使用指南,帮助开发者快速上手。
-
示例代码:GitHub上提供了大量的示例代码,展示了jPlayer 在不同场景下的应用。
jPlayer的应用场景
jPlayer 的应用非常广泛,以下是一些典型的应用场景:
-
音乐网站:许多音乐网站使用jPlayer 来播放音频文件。例如,个人博客或小型音乐分享平台可以利用jPlayer 提供流畅的音乐播放体验。
-
教育平台:在线教育平台可以使用jPlayer 来播放教学视频或音频课程,确保跨平台的兼容性。
-
播客:播客网站可以利用jPlayer 的HTML5支持,提供高质量的音频播放服务。
-
游戏:一些网页游戏使用jPlayer 来播放背景音乐或音效,增强用户体验。
-
企业应用:企业内部的培训视频、产品介绍视频等都可以通过jPlayer 实现。
jPlayer的优势
- 跨平台兼容:支持HTML5和Flash回退,确保在各种设备和浏览器上都能正常工作。
- 高度定制化:开发者可以根据需求定制播放器的外观和功能。
- 轻量级:jPlayer 的代码非常精简,加载速度快,适合性能要求高的应用。
- 社区支持:活跃的社区意味着问题可以快速得到解决,功能不断更新。
如何使用jPlayer
要使用jPlayer,开发者需要:
- 下载或克隆:从GitHub 上下载或克隆jPlayer 的源代码。
- 引入依赖:在项目中引入必要的JavaScript和CSS文件。
- 初始化播放器:通过JavaScript代码初始化jPlayer,并配置播放列表和播放选项。
- 样式定制:根据需求调整播放器的样式。
结语
jPlayer 作为一个开源项目,不仅为开发者提供了强大的多媒体播放功能,还通过GitHub 平台展现了开源社区的活力和合作精神。无论你是想为个人项目添加音乐播放功能,还是为企业应用提供视频播放服务,jPlayer 都是一个值得考虑的选择。通过jPlayer GitHub,你可以获得最新的更新和社区支持,确保你的项目始终保持在技术的前沿。
希望这篇文章能帮助你更好地了解jPlayer,并在你的项目中找到它的用武之地。